Posted: February 12, 2007 Job title: Interchange web developer Company name: End Point Corporation Location: United States, NY, New York Travel: 0-25% Terms of employment: Salaried employee Hours: Full time Onsite: no Description: Growing consulting company End Point Corporation seeks a strong Perl programmer to develop web applications. We're especially interested in individuals with deep database experience (complex SQL queries, custom functions, constraints, triggers, etc.). Our developers interact directly with our clients via telephone and email, so we require excellent verbal and written communication skills. Good candidates pay attention to detail, are careful with production systems, and code defensively to provide good stability and maintainability of mission-critical systems. This is a full-time salaried position. Employees work either from home offices or at our office in Manhattan, and must live in the 48 contiguous United States. An applicant must be a U.S. citizen or permanent resident allowed to work in the U.S. Required skills: Perl, Linux/Unix, web application development. Exposure to the Interchange application server is a plus, and willingness to learn it well is a necessity. Desired skills: PostgreSQL and/or MySQL, HTML and CSS, JavaScript, e-commerce experience.
